In today’s episode, I’m joined by Deatrich Wise, New England Patriots defensive end and Walter Payton Man of the Year nominee. We talk about what it means to be recognized for service beyond the field, the impact of his Wise Up Foundation, and the lessons he’s carried from his family and mentors. He shares how he’s learned to balance giving with receiving, the books that have shaped his leadership approach, and why strong locker room culture extends beyond football.
